"Songs of a Sunlit Summer"
Photo by Keriliwi on Unsplash

In the summer's golden glow, young hearts all aflutter,

Youngsters gather 'round, ice cream dreams they utter.

Their eyes wide with delight, flavors to discover,

A symphony of sweetness, each taste a secret lover.

With cones in hand, they laugh and share,

Their joy filling the warm, sun-kissed air.

Chocolates and vanillas, strawberries divine,

A rainbow of scoops, happiness entwined.

Sticky fingers and giggles, a mess they don't mind,

Ice cream mustaches, evidence you'll find.

Running through sprinklers, carefree and bold,

Youngsters savoring each icy, creamy fold.

Their laughter contagious, like a summer's breeze,

They relish in the joy, their hearts at ease.

Childhood memories, forever they'll keep,

Of youthful innocence, and ice cream dreams so deep.

In the twilight's gentle glow, as stars begin to gleam,

Youngsters bid farewell, but hold onto the ice cream dream.
